Obrestad Loses to Ace-King High

Level 7 : 2,000/4,000, 0 ante

She's still in with a lammer and 31,000 chips, but Annette Obrestad couldn't believe she lost to Tres Davis' ace-king high.

Both players got the chips they could in pre flop and the cards were on their backs.

Obrestad: {j-Diamonds}{q-Spades}{a-Diamonds}{10-Hearts}
Davis: {k-Clubs}{a-Spades}{9-Spades}{q-Hearts}

The board ran {6-Diamonds}{5-Clubs}{8-Hearts}{3-Hearts}{5-Spades}.

Davis asked after the flop if he could win, "one time", with ace-king high and he got his wish,

Ryyannen Cashes In Lammers

Level 7 : 2,000/4,000, 0 ante

One the last remaining matches where neither player had used any of their rebuy lammers was between Andy Frankenberger and Sampo Ryyannen. Frankenberger opened a hand, Ryyannen shoved and Frankenberger called.

Frankenberger: {Q-Diamonds} {J-Spades} {9-Spades} {9-Hearts}
Ryyannen: {A-Diamonds} {K-Clubs} {J-Hearts} {7-Clubs}

The board ran {4-Spades} {2-Diamonds} {5-Spades} {6-Hearts} {7-Hearts} and Frankenberger's pair of nines held. Ryyannen cashed in both his remaining lammers and Frankenberger still has his two.

DW Getting Short

Level 7 : 2,000/4,000, 0 ante

David Williams is down 25,900 and his last lammer after losing a hand to Yevgeniy Timoshenko.

Timoshenko raised to 4,000 and Williams peeled to see an {a-Hearts}{2-Diamonds}{2-Spades} flop. Timoshenko continued for 3,200 and called after Williams check-raised to 8,500.

Both players checked through the the {8-Clubs} turn before Williams check-called a 9,000 bet on the {j-Hearts} river. Timoshenko opened {a-Spades}{5-Clubs} and scooped as Williams mucked.

It looks as if Williams is waiting for the PLO round, coming up shortly, to cash in his final lammer.

Sexton Rolling

Level 7 : 2,000/4,000, 0 ante
Mike Sexton playing fast for a reason.
Mike Sexton playing fast for a reason.

Mike Sexton has Andy Seth down to his last rebuy lammer. In the first 20 minutes he took his first lammer and right before the level change he took the other. Seth moved all in preflop and Sexton called.

Seth: {A-Spades} {Q-Clubs}
Sexton: {A-Diamonds} {K-Diamonds}

The board ran {6-Spades} {A-Hearts} {5-Spades} {6-Diamonds} {5-Diamonds} and Seth gave the dealer his last rebuy chip.

Sexton has incentive to play fast, he's also in Event 4 Stud HiLo with an average stack.
